W. J. Francis 1964 California Quail. March 25. Strawberry Canyon, Alameda Co. 1743. Three ♂ and two ♀ feeding in a close group in D-4., joined after a moment by another ♂ and ♀; grainings not in ♂-♀ pairs. 1746. Birds took cover following motorcycle passing on the highway. No further activity until end of observation at 1820. March 27. 1635 Flushed a ♂ and a ♀ from grass cover in A-10 while setting mouse traps - these two close together and separated from the others. April 5. 1720 all eight birds in the Belovia lab pen flushed from area B-6 when I started to spread grain & check rain gage. One ♀ fluttered along the ground as if unable to fly, 1750 Several assembly calls heard, then saw one ♂ in E-5 who quickly ran out of sight, 1757 No further activity, with last sun- light now off the pen structure. 1806 All ♂ birds feeding in E-2, then drifted into taller cover within 3 minutes. 1821 A ♂ & ♀ together in C-6, signs of other birds nesting in tall grass; another ♀ joined the pair
